Introduction <br />This document is the proposed decision of the Colorado Division of Reclamation, Mining and Safety <br />(the Division) in response to a request for a combination of Phase I, II and III bond release at the Munger <br />Canyon Mine, Division file number C- 1981 -020. The package contains four parts. These include: 1) <br />procedures and summary of the bond release process; 2) criteria and schedule for bond release; 3) <br />observations and findings of the Division regarding compliance with the bond release requirements of <br />the Colorado Surface Coal Mining and Reclamation Act (CSCMRA) and regulations promulgated <br />thereunder; and 4) the Division's proposed decision on the request for bond release. <br />Detailed information about the review process can be found in the Act and the Regulations of the <br />Colorado Mined Land Reclamation Board for Coal Mining. All Rules referenced within this document <br />are contained within the Regulations. Detailed information about the mining and reclamation operations <br />can be found in the permit application on file at the Division offices, located at 1313 Sherman Street, <br />Room 215, in Denver, Colorado. <br />The Munger Canyon Mine is an underground which was permitted and operated by CAM Mining, LLC <br />(CAM). The ownership of the land for which bond release has been requested is federal and private, and <br />the coal ownership is federal. Reclamation for which bond release has been requested was conducted <br />during the years 2001, 2004, 2006 and 2007. <br />
